Understanding Licensing and Regulation: The Foundation of Trust

The cornerstone of any trustworthy online casino is its licensing. In Ireland, online casinos must be licensed by a recognised regulatory body. This license serves as proof that the casino adheres to strict standards of operation, including fair play, responsible gambling practices, and player protection. The most reputable licenses come from jurisdictions with rigorous oversight,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). These regulators conduct thorough background checks on casino operators, ensuring they are financially stable and operate with integrity. They also regularly audit the casino’s games, payment systems, and security protocols. Always check for the licensing information, usually displayed prominently on the casino’s website, often in the footer. This information should include the license number and the issuing regulatory body. If you can’t find this information, or if the license details seem unclear, it’s a major red flag.

The Role of Independent Auditors

Beyond licensing, independent auditors play a crucial role in verifying the fairness of casino games. These auditors, such as eCOGRA (e-Commer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) or iTech Labs, are third-party organizations that test the Random Number Generators (RNGs) used in casino games. RNGs are algorithms that ensure the outcome of each game is truly random and unbiased. The auditors check that the RNGs are functioning correctly and that the games are not rigged in favour of the casino. They also assess the casino’s payout percentages to ensure they align with the advertised Return to Player (RTP) rates. A casino that has been certified by an independent auditor will proudly display this certification on its website, often with a link to the auditor’s report. This provides players with an added layer of assurance that the games are fair.

Prioritising Security: Protecting Your Personal and Financial Information

Security is paramount in the online gambling world. Reputable online casinos employ robust security measures to protect players’ personal and financial information from cyber threats. This includes using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ption technology to encrypt data transmitted between the player’s device and the casino’s servers. SSL encryption makes it virtually impossible for hackers to intercept and steal sensitive information, such as credit card details or login credentials. Look for the padlock icon in the address bar of your browser, which indicates that the website is using SSL encryption. Additionally, online casinos implement other security protocols, such as firewalls and fraud detection systems, to prevent unauthorized access to player accounts and financial transactions. They also adhere to strict data privacy policies, ensuring that player information is handled responsibly and in compliance with data protection regulations.

Secure Payment Methods

The availability of secure and trusted payment methods is another indicator of a trustworthy online casino. Reputable casinos offer a variety of payment options,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. These payment methods are known for their security and reliability. Furthermore, the casino should clearly outline its deposit and withdrawal procedures, including any associated fees or processing times. Be wary of casinos that offer only a limited number of payment options or that have unclear payment policies. Always check that the payment methods you intend to use are supported and that the casino has a good reputation for processing withdrawals promptly and efficiently.

Promoting Responsible Gambling: A Commitment to Player Wellbeing

A responsible online casino prioritises the wellbeing of its players. This means providing tools and resources to help players gamble responsibly and avoid problem gambling. These tools often include de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ount they can deposit within a specified period, helping them control their spending. Loss limits allow players to set a maximum amount they can lose within a specified period. Self-exclusion allows players to temporarily or permanently block themselves from accessing the casino’s services. Reputable casinos also provide links to resources for problem gambling support, such as GamCare or Gamblers Anonymous. They may also have dedicated responsible gambling pages on their websites, with information about recognizing the signs of problem gambling and seeking help. A casino that actively promotes responsible gambling demonstrates its commitment to player welfare and its dedication to operating ethically.

Transparency and Customer Support: Building a Relationship of Trust

Transparency is key to building trust. A reputable online casino will be transparent about its terms and conditions, bonus offers, and payout percentages. The terms and conditions should be clearly stated and easy to understand. Bonus offers should be fair and transparent, with clear wagering requirements. The casino should also provide information about its payout percentages, which indicate the average percentage of money wagered that is returned to players over time. Good customer support is another vital component of a trustworthy online casino. The casino should offer multiple channels of communication, such as live chat, email, and phone support. Customer support representatives should be knowledgeable, responsive, and helpful in resolving player queries and issues. A casino that provides excellent customer support demonstrates its commitment to player satisfaction and its willingness to address any concerns promptly and fairly.
